Claims (2)

2개의 유도기와, 이들 각 유도기의 회전속도의 더하기 도는 빼기를 꺼내어, 이것을 출력측에 전달하는 차동기구를 갖추고, 상기 각 유도기의 회전수에 따라서 상기 출력축의 토오크를 제어하도록 한 차동식 액츄에이터의 토오크제어방식에 있어서, 상기 각 유도기를 동일 또는 다른 전압/주파수 출력특성을 가진 독자적인 인버어터에 의해서 구동 제어하도록 한 것을 특징으로 하는 차동식 액츄에이터의 토오크제어방식.Torque control method of a differential actuator provided with two inductors and a differential mechanism for extracting the addition or subtraction of the rotational speed of each inductor and transmitting them to the output side, and controlling the torque of the output shaft in accordance with the rotation speed of each inductor. The torque control method of a differential actuator according to claim 1, wherein each inductor is driven and controlled by an independent inverter having the same or different voltage / frequency output characteristics. 제 1항에 있어서, 한쪽의 유도기에는 일정한 주파수신호를 입력하고, 다른 쪽의 유도기에는 가변주파수신호를 입력하므로서, 각 가변주파수마다 회전속도에 대해서 출력축에 얻어지는 토오크를 일정하게 제어하도록 한 것을 특징으로 하는 차동식 액츄에이터의 토오크제어장치.The torque obtained at the output shaft according to claim 1 is characterized in that a constant frequency signal is input to one inductor and a variable frequency signal is input to the other inductor.
